Questions & Answers

What companies run services between Assago Milanofiori Forum, Italy and Florence, Italy?

Trenitalia Frecce operates a train from Milano Rogoredo to Firenze S.M.N. every 30 minutes. Tickets cost €40–90 and the journey takes 1h 45m. Two other operators also service this route.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Milan to Florence Villa Constanza Bus Station via Bologna and Bologna Centrale in around 4h 16m.
